• サぺルOP
    link
    fedilink
    arrow-up
    1
    ·
    2 years ago

    To rzeczywiście kapa. W wielu bibliotekach C też istnieją potwory. Głównie, kiedy twórca udaje, że wie lepiej jak powinienem zarządzać zasobami. Potem wygląda to tak samo jak architektura zarządzania w C++/Rust, tylko muszę pamiętać, jakie w tym tygodniu wymyślił nazwy funkcji do dealokacji (jedna z popularnych bibliotek ma przynajmniej dwie nazwy). No i ukrywanie struktur za setterami/getterami.

    Jak pamiętam to Linus narzekał zawsze od czasów 2.4/2.6. Mówił, że to przerośnięty bloat.

    Czyli można powiedzieć, że w JS można łatwiej zarządzać pamięcią niż w Rust.